Mermaid Game Progress Update 2

Continuation of previous progress video showing new features and updates completed in the last few months, as before just a note to say this is a very early preview just to show progress and hopefully gain interest for a later release (hopefully towards the end of 2023 but there is so much still to do so lets see how it goes). There are bugs here and there and its unfinished, many things are currently placeholders which will be improved on later. The most requested feature in the comments on the last video was for character selection and customization. This is now in and shown in this video. There is a Merman and Mermaid to pick from as well as ability to change some colours (hair, body, tail, eyes) as this feature is now in this can be extended on as needed in the future. Mermaid/Merman transform will possibly be a quest reward that must be collected before you can transform otherwise regular human swim is used. As a Human there is also an oxygen limitation where you will lose health and die if you stay underwater for too long, this is removed as you gain the transformation ability. The bow weapon has been extended with a few different types, some with special abilities others without and have different levels of damage, these will be quest rewards for progressing through the story. The Parkour system has been extended with ladder and pole climbing/sliding, wall running has also been added as well as huge improvements in IK and motion warping. Clipping issues have been addressed and I have packed in a few more fish and sea decorations for this video. New menu level added and some UI updates. The start of the quest system has been added, currently supporting tracking of quests for defeat x enemies, go to location x, speak to person x, retrieve items xyz with all the usual core and side quest functionality and cutscenes. lots of fixes in the background and performance enhancements but still a long list ahead for fixes and new features before i can begin on the world and quest building. For the next video I’m hoping I can show some water surface and foliage interaction with the player, as well as the start of the underwater kingdom and maybe some underwater player building and enemy sharks.
